Lexicon :: Strong's H259 - 'eḥāḏ

Choose a new font size and typeface
אֶחָד
Transliteration
'eḥāḏ
Pronunciation
ekh-awd'
Listen
Part of Speech
adjective
Root Word (Etymology)
A numeral from אָחַד (H258)
Dictionary Aids

TWOT Reference: 61

Strong’s Definitions

אֶחָד ʼechâd, ekh-awd'; a numeral from H258; properly, united, i.e. one; or (as an ordinal) first:—a, alike, alone, altogether, and, any(-thing), apiece, a certain, (dai-) ly, each (one), eleven, every, few, first, highway, a man, once, one, only, other, some, together,


KJV Translation Count — Total: 952x

The KJV translates Strong's H259 in the following manner: one (687x), first (36x), another (35x), other (30x), any (18x), once (13x), eleven (with H6240) (13x), every (10x), certain (9x), an (7x), some (7x), miscellaneous (87x).

  1. one (number)

    1. one (number)

    2. each, every

    3. a certain

    4. an (indefinite article)

    5. only, once, once for all

    6. one...another, the one...the other, one after another, one by one

    7. first

    8. eleven (in combination), eleventh (ordinal)

STRONGS H259: Abbreviations
אֶחָד 962 adjective number one (Phoenician אחד, Sabean id., compare DHMZMG 1876, 707, Arabic أَحَدً, Ethiopic አሐዱ፡ Aramaic חַד, dfo; on Assyrian edu, aḫadu, compare DlW No. 139) — absoluteא׳ Genesis 1:5אַחַ֫ד Genesis 21:15 +; so even before preposition 1 Samuel 9:3 and elsewhere see Dr; feminine absolute אַחַ֫ת Genesis 2:21 +; אֶחָ֑תGenesis 11:1 +; construct אַחַ֫ת Deuteronomy 13:13 +; plural masculine אֲחָדִים Genesis 11:1 + 4:t.; חַד Ezekiel 33:30 strike out Co compare Greek Version of the LXX; —
1. one Genesis 1:9; Genesis 27:38, 45; Exodus 12:49; Joshua 23:10; 1 Samuel 1:24; 2 Samuel 12:3 +, Zechariah 14:9; Malachi 2:10; Job 31:15 +, so also (emphatic) 2 Samuel 17:3 for MT אֲשֶׁר Greek Version of the LXX We Dr; one or two לֹא לְיוֺם אֶחָד וְלֹא לִשְׁנַיִם Ezra 10:13; as substantive followed by מִן Genesis 2:21; Leviticus 4:2, 13; Isaiah 34:16 +; הָא׳ Genesis 19:9; Genesis 42:13, 32; 2 Kings 6:3, 5 +; one and the same Genesis 40:5; Job 31:15; plural דְּבָרִים אֲחָדִים Genesis 11:1 compare Ezekiel 37:17 (absolute), but see Co;=few, a few יָמִים א׳Genesis 27:44; Genesis 29:20; Daniel 11:20; כְּאִישׁ אֶחָד as one man, together Judges 20:8; 1 Samuel 11:7; also כְּאֶחָד late=Aramaic כַּחֲדָאEzra 2:64 (= Nehemiah 7:66) Ezra 3:9; Ezra 6:20; Ecclesiastes 11:6; see especially Isaiah 65:25 (|| earlier יַחְדֶּו Isaiah 11:6, 7).
2.each, every Exodus 36:30; Numbers 7:3, 85; Numbers 28:21; 1 Kings 4:7; 2 Kings 15:20 +; also repeated, distributive sense Numbers 7:11; Numbers 13:2; Numbers 17:21; Joshua 3:12; Joshua 4:2, 4.
4.=indefinite article 1 Samuel 6:7; 1 Samuel 24:15; 1 Samuel 26:20 (but strike out Greek Version of the LXX We Dr) 1 Kings 19:4, 5 +.
5. only 1 Kings 4:19; & (feminine) once 2 Kings 6:10; Psalm 62:12; Psalm 89:36 (once for all); אַחַת לְשָׁלוֺשׁ שָׁנִים 2 Chronicles 9:21, בַּשָּׁנָה א׳ Leviticus 16:34 compare Job 40:5, אֶחָ֑ת אֶחָ֑ת Joshua 6:3, 11 compare Joshua 6:14, בְּאַחַת Numbers 10:4; Job 33:14; at once בְּאֶחָ֑ת Proverbs 28:18 compare וְאִנָּקְמֶה נְקַם־אַחַת Judges 16:28. **Num 10:4 בְּאַחַת is rather 'in one (of the trumpets)'; Job 33:14 it=in one way; Proverbs 28:18 read probably with Syriac Version Lag Dy Bi בַּשָּׁ֑חַת; Judges 16:28 is rather 'vengeance for one of my two eyes' (see GFM). Jeremiah 10:8 בְּאַחַת probably=in one, altogether. אחד.
6. one... another, the one... the other א׳⬩⬩⬩א׳ Exodus 17:12; Exodus 18:3, 4; Amos 4:7; 2 Samuel 12:1; Jeremiah 24:2; 2 Chronicles 3:17; Nehemiah 4:11 +; 2 Samuel 14:6 read הָאֶחָד אֶת־אָחִיו for האחד את־האחד Greek Version of the LXX We Dr; one after another, one by one, לְאַחַד אֶחָד Isaiah 27:12 compare Ecclesiastes 7:27.
7. as ordinal, first (mostly P & late) Genesis 1:5 (P) Genesis 2:11 (J) Exodus 39:10 (P); absolute Job 42:14, Ezekiel 10:14 especially of first day of month Exodus 40:2 (P) Ezra 3:6; Ezra 10:16, 17; Nehemiah 8:2; Haggai 1:1; first year, שְׁנַת אַחַת 2 Chronicles 36:22; Ezra 1:1; Daniel 1:21; Daniel 9:1, 2; Daniel 11:1 compare first (day, יוֺם omitted) Genesis 8:5, 13 בְּאֶחָד לַחֹדֶשׁ; so Exodus 40:17; Leviticus 23:24; Numbers 1:18; Numbers 29:1; Numbers 33:38 (all P) Deuteronomy 1:3; 2 Chronicles 29:17; Ezra 7:9 (twice in verse); Ezekiel 26:1; Ezekiel 29:17; Ezekiel 31:1; Ezekiel 32:1; Ezekiel 45:18.
8. in combination,
a. אַחַד עָשָׂר eleven (compare עָשָׂר, עַשְׁתֵּי) Genesis 32:23; Genesis 37:9 (JE) Deuteronomy 1:2; so אַחַת־עֶשְׂרֵה Joshua 15:51 (P) 2 Kings 23:36; 2 Kings 24:18; 2 Chronicles 36:5, 11; Jeremiah 52:1 (precedes noun, except Joshua 15:51; as ordinal, eleventh אַחַת עֶשְׂרֵה שָׁנָה Ezekiel 30:20; Ezekiel 31:1 compare 1 Kings 6:38; 2 Kings 9:29;
b. with other numerals, as cardinal אֶחָד וְאַרְבָּעִים אֶלֶף וַחֲמֵשׁ מֵאוֺת Numbers 1:41; compare Numbers 2:16, 28; Numbers 31:34, 39 (all P; א׳ precedes other numeral); but אַרְבָּיִם וְאַחַת שָׁנָה (א׳ following) 1 Kings 14:21; 1 Kings 15:10; 2 Kings 14:23; 2 Chronicles 12:13 compare 2 Kings 22:1 2 Chronicles 34:1; 2 Kings 24:18Jeremiah 52:1 2 Chronicles 36:11; Joshua 12:24 (D) Isaiah 30:17; Ezra 2:26Nehemiah 7:30 compare Nehemiah 7:37; Daniel 10:13; as ordinal בְּאַחַת וְשֵׁשׁ מֵאוֺת שָׁנָה Genesis 8:13 (P) Exodus 12:18 (P), 1 Chronicles 24:17; 1 Chronicles 25:28; 2 Chronicles 16:13 (א׳ preceding); but 1 Kings 16:23; Haggai 2:1 (א׳ following).
